Home insurance doesn't just protect your house. It protects both your home and your precious belongings. If you experience vandalism or a fire, you may have damage to some of your possessions as well as damage to the home itself. If your belongings are not insured, you won't get any money to replace your things. Some of your valuables can be protected from theft or loss outside of your home, like if your car is stolen with your computer inside it or your bicycle is stolen from work.
